Customers are saying

Customers are delighted by the My Cloud Expert EX2 Ultra 2-Bay 8TB External Network Attached Storage (NAS) for its easy setup, ample storage, and reliability. Users appreciate the user-friendly software and intuitive instructions that make setting up the NAS quick and simple. The storage capacity is seen as impressive, providing ample space for photos, videos, and backups. Customers also value the price of the NAS, considering it a decent value for the capacity it offers. However, some customers have concerns about the NAS's internet access and video playback capabilities. Some users find that accessing the NAS away from home is a bit complicated, while others experience issues with video playback.

    An HP tech put me on the path to storing my large number of photos on a NAS. He recommended a different brand, but since I already had a WD MY BOOK I stayed with WD. I read a lot of reviews and recommendations before finalizing my decision and opting for the WD. In the process I learned the value and advantage of a 2-bay system. The price was great compared to other NAS options and I chose the 8TB EX2 ULTRA. In all honesty the first one died in 4 days. The second one has some idiosyncrasies which I had to understand and get used to, namely it gets "tired" when uploading many large files. Rebooting solves that problem. I also initially misunderstood that it really is only for storage. It is complicated to "share" anything on the ULTRA with anyone else: they cannot print what you are sending. The main reason I bought an NAS was because the huge number of photos had nearly used up my computer space. Since I cannot readily access a photo or document to reprint it or send it I downloaded everything to DVDs, carefully itemizing the contents of the DVD. I chose not to sync everything, since I was deleting the saved photos from my computer to gain space. You can only sync what remains on the computer. In spite of the "shortcomings" for my purpose, I really love the ULTRA. It is incredibly fast and quiet.

    Microsoft discontinued their Home Server so we needed a new place to share and backup data on the network. After doing reviews the WD - My Cloud EX2 Ultra was the best choice. It took a little time to figure out how we wanted the storage configured (striped or mirrored), but once this was set it was smooth sailing. We mapped a drive letter on all of the computers to the public folder for sharing of files and mapped a drive to a user directory for each user for backup of the computers. We have a gigabyte network and accessing and copying files is extremely fast. We highly recommend this product.
